繁体   English   中英

迅速在模态和推式搜索之间保持导航

[英]Swift keep navigation between modal and push segue

我的应用程序从带有导航栏的tableView开始。

如果我按导航栏中的搜索图标,则新的segue将显示为“模态存在”。 我需要将其保持为“模态呈现”,因为我正在使用特殊的库以获取自定义的segue动画。

无论如何,从第二个VC中,我有另一个设置为“ Show”的segue,以显示另一个tableView,您可以在其中选择一些过滤器。 当您获得此VC时,将在后退按钮上显示。

如何在VC2-VC3之间实现后退按钮?

编辑:

在VC2和VC3之间,我放置了一个导航控制器,这似乎可行。 但这是这样做的方式吗?

这意味着我的故事板上有两个导航控制器:

导航控制器 > VC1 (当前以模式方式出现)> VC2 > 导航控制器 (root vc)> VC3

如果将第二个视图控制器嵌入导航控制器中,则应在按下第三个视图控制器后获得“后退”按钮。 这意味着您将模态显示导航控制器,而不是第二个视图控制器,但是第二个视图控制器将成为导航控制器的根。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M